Nikola Nedovic is a scholar working on Electrical and Electronic Engineering, Hardware and Architecture and Computer Networks and Communications. According to data from OpenAlex, Nikola Nedovic has authored 39 papers receiving a total of 761 indexed citations (citations by other indexed papers that have themselves been cited), including 37 papers in Electrical and Electronic Engineering, 10 papers in Hardware and Architecture and 8 papers in Computer Networks and Communications. Recurrent topics in Nikola Nedovic's work include Low-power high-performance VLSI design (18 papers), Advancements in PLL and VCO Technologies (12 papers) and Semiconductor Lasers and Optical Devices (11 papers). Nikola Nedovic is often cited by papers focused on Low-power high-performance VLSI design (18 papers), Advancements in PLL and VCO Technologies (12 papers) and Semiconductor Lasers and Optical Devices (11 papers). Nikola Nedovic collaborates with scholars based in United States, United Kingdom and Japan. Nikola Nedovic's co-authors include Vojin G. Oklobdzija, Vladimir Stojanović, Dejan Marković, C. Thomas Gray, M. Aleksić, William W. Walker, Brian Zimmer, William J. Dally, Stephen G. Tell and John W. Poulton and has published in prestigious journals such as IEEE Journal of Solid-State Circuits, Journal of Lightwave Technology and IEEE Transactions on Circuits and Systems I Regular Papers.
